Determining the ideal water pump size for your application is essential . You'll find a range of water pumps , and understanding their capacity—often specified by outlet pipe bore –is key. A one-inch discharge pipe generally handles lower flow rates, suitable for smaller jobs like draining basements . Selecting a 1.5-inch or larger tube allows the unit to move a greater volume of water, perfect for agricultural needs . Always consider the total head pressure – the vertical distance water must be lifted plus friction loss - when choosing your Honda water device; an undersized unit will struggle and may overheat, while an oversized one is simply inefficient.

Selecting your Right Honda Water Pump: 1 Inch vs. 1.5"

Deciding on a 1-inch or 1.5-inch Honda honda equipment water pump can be tricky , particularly for novices to the world of pumping . The primary difference lies in their flow rate ; a 1.5-inch model generally moves a larger volume of water per minute , making it better suited for demanding tasks like large-scale irrigation or shifting water over longer distances and at greater heights. However, this increased performance comes with a price tag ; 1.5-inch pumps are typically more expensive and may require a more powerful power source. If you're only using the pump for smaller applications like filling a pool or supplying a small garden, a 1-inch model will likely suffice . Carefully consider your specific needs and budget to arrive at the optimal selection.

Maximize Output: Water Pump Options for Your 10kW Honda Generator

To boost the effectiveness of your 10kW Honda generator, pairing it with a suitable water pump is critical. Several options exist, each offering different characteristics. Consider the amount of water you need to pump; smaller pumps, around 1-2 horsepower, are enough for basic tasks like watering a small pond or irrigation. For more demanding applications – such as powering a pressure washer or transferring larger quantities of water – you'll want a larger pump, potentially 3-5 horsepower. Ensure the water pump’s starting and running wattage doesn't exceed your generator’s capacity, generally staying below 7kW to allow for other loads. Below is a breakdown:

  • Small Irrigation/Pond Filling: A 1-2 HP pump offers excellent performance.
  • Pressure Washing/Larger Transfers: Opt for a 3-5 HP water unit.
  • Check Wattage Requirements: Ensure the pump’s power demand is within your generator's range.

Remember to factor in the height the water needs to be lifted (head pressure) as this directly affects water transfer performance.
